What is a driver's license?
A driver's licence is a document that permits you to drive in a vehicle. The license card usually includes your name, date of birth address, photo, and date of birth. It may also contain additional information, such as authorized vehicle types and blood groups. In the United States drivers can get an enhanced driver's license which contains all the information and also includes a gold or black star in the upper-right corner to identify themselves as a Real ID-compliant driver.
There are different classes of driver's licenses in the country. Each one gives you the right to drive a certain kind of vehicle. The most common type of license is Class D. It allows you to drive cars with a an overall weight rating (GVWR) which is less than 26,000 pounds. This covers the majority of passenger cars smaller trailers, as well as recreational vehicles.
You must pass both the road and written tests to obtain the Class D license at your local Department of Motor Vehicles office. The test is typically scheduled in advance. You'll also need to bring your permit along with the proof of enrollment in the pre-licensing classes, as well as your Social Security card. It's recommended to read the Driver's Manual and practice driving as much as you can before you sit for your test.

How do I apply for a driver's license?
New York's driver's licensing process starts by submitting an application at the DMV. Candidates must show evidence of identity and proof of legal status such as an original social security card or birth certificate, passport, W-2 form with the correct name and address, and proof of New York residency, such as rent stubs, pay stubs, or receipts.
The applicant must then take a mandatory pre-licensing session. The course is available at local high schools, colleges and DMV-approved driving schools. It is recommended that applicants take a driving test with an approved driver who is 21 years old or older. The applicant must also record 50 hours of driving under supervision of which 15 hours must be in high traffic and moderately busy roads.
After the applicant has passed all of the required tests, he / will be able to take the road test. The road test is the in-car portion of the licensing process and is designed to test a new driver's ability to drive the vehicle in accordance with all New York state driving laws. The driver must pass this test in order to obtain a full NY license.
The applicant must bring a car in good condition, insured and sporting an official safety inspection sticker to the DMV. If the applicant holds a Learner’s Permit, they will need an approved driver who is 21 years old or older to sit in the front seat during the road test. The new driver will need to wait at least six months prior to scheduling the road test.
